    Be this as it may, we still use medical terms which first appeared in the writings of Hippocrates; and it is said by Edmund Andrews, in A History of Scientific English, that 75 percent of present-day medical English can be traced back to the Greek of Hippocrates and of the Alexandrine school of the following period.
